Tips For Choosing the Right Cleaning Contractor

When a fireplace happens during a restaurant, studies show that it most frequently begins in the kitchen.
That's why it is important not only to have kitchen hood systems cleaned of flammable build-up on a routine basis, however to own them cleaned by a skilled who knows a way to perform the work properly.

Restaurant fires typically occur when a flame ignites cooking materials that are left to build up in kitchen hoods, fans and ducts.
When you're talking regarding grease and oil build-up, you're talking regarding a substance that can't be removed without special chemicals and tools, and if it is not properly removed on a daily basis, poses a tremendous hearth hazard.
There are some criteria restaurant managers and homeowners will use when choosing a professional exhaust cleaning company to assist guarantee they have selected the proper person for the job.
One of the first questions to ask is to request details regarding the scope of the cleaning services.
There are firms out there that will clean the hood solely, and never touch the ducts or the exhaust fans. Not cleaning each part of the system will leave the restaurant prone to vital property damage within the event of a fire.
It is also a smart plan to raise concerning the inspection and cleaning standards that the company follows. Most reputable companies abide by the established standards printed in the following codes:
o NFPA-ninety six: the standard for ventilation management and hearth protection of business cooking operations.
o The International Fire Code: includes regulations that govern the protection of life and property from varying explosions and fireplace hazards.
o The International Mechanical Code: establishes minimum laws for mechanical systems using prescriptive and performance-related provisions.
These codes are designed to provide general safety provisions, outline maintenance of hood systems and fireplace protection systems, forestall fires and limit the negative impact of fires when they occur.
Corporations ought to be willing to produce proof of insurance, licenses and certifications. They also should be able to produce dates for when the work will begin and when it can be completed, as well as information about what specifically can be done during the cleaning process. Upon completion of the work, professional companies should provide something in writing that outlines what was done, any deficiencies that were found and proposals on things that ought to be repaired or replaced. The company conjointly ought to provide a certificate of performance that can be placed near the hood as proof that it's been serviced and therefore the date of the cleaning or inspection.
A list of references that restaurant owners and managers can contact also ought to be provided by companies upon request.
